Job description
Overview
Cochin Refineries School has opened applications for a Front Office Executive in Ernakulam, Kerala. The role suits educators who pair classroom rigour with genuine care for student wellbeing. Cochin Refineries School in Ernakulam, Kerala is a senior secondary institution — a CBSE-affiliated school, established 1966,. The school pairs a traditional academic core with modern classroom practices and consistent investment in faculty enablement. Role: the Front Office Executive keeps the school's day-to-day operations running. You own the assigned function end-to-end — process, paperwork, vendor coordination, and timely escalation to leadership. What you will do:
- Act as the single point of ownership for the assigned function.
- Follow defined process flows and keep records audit-ready.
- Provide leadership with accurate, timely operational information.
- Work with external vendors to ensure quality service delivery.
- Support the operations team during exam cycles and large events. Ideal candidate — you have:
- Prior experience in a school or service-oriented organisation.
- A neat, systematic style with paperwork and records.
- Good interpersonal skills with parents and staff.
- Discipline to maintain registers, logs, and trackers accurately.
- A learning mindset for new tools the school adopts. Why join us:
